{"data":{"id":"us/46-cfr-148.320","jurisdiction":"us","citation":"46 CFR 148.320","heading":"Tankage; garbage tankage; rough ammonia tankage; or tankage fertilizer.","body":"(a) This part applies to rough ammonia tankage in bulk that contains 7 percent or more moisture by weight, and garbage tankage and tankage fertilizer that contains 8 percent or more moisture by weight.\n(b) Tankage to which this part applies may not be loaded in bulk if its temperature exceeds 38 °C (100 °F).\n(c) During the voyage, the temperature of the tankage must be monitored often enough to detect spontaneous heating.","path":["Title 46—Shipping","CHAPTER I—COAST GUARD, DEPARTMENT OF HOMELAND SECURITY","SUBCHAPTER N—DANGEROUS CARGOES","PART 148—CARRIAGE OF BULK SOLID MATERIALS THAT REQUIRE SPECIAL HANDLING","Subpart E—Special Requirements for Certain Materials"],"source_url":"https://www.ecfr.gov/api/versioner/v1/full/2026-08-25/title-46.xml","current_through":"2026-08-25","vintage":"","retrieved_at":"2026-08-27T02:26:22Z","sha256":"63d41f226f489efa3cae5a2c5b995fccef32c6e507f52641898b97842a989ede","source_id":"us-cfr","stale":true,"prev":"us/46-cfr-148.315","next":"us/46-cfr-148.325"},"notice":"GroundRules: Original legal text.
